What to expect in this year's Boxing Day and January sales

TV deals

Boxing Day and the January sales have always been a good time to snag a TV discount and we hope the events of this year are no exception. Currys, Amazon and John Lewis in particular are going to be the retailers to beat, although AO.com, Very and Box should all have great deals in their own right as well. Although it's still early days, the Boxing Day sales have traditionally been a good time to get your hands on the latest releases from the year before - think fancy new OLED or QLED displays. Newer features also tend to trickle down to more affordable models, so if you're looking for something a bit more affordable, you need to be well taken care of as well. In particular, this year's TVs have really focused on accepting next-gen gaming consoles, the PS5 and Xbox Series X, so if you're one of the lucky few who owns a console, you should be able to come to a deal. on a capable TV as well.

Computer and laptop deals

Although Black Friday and Cyber ​​Monday are traditionally touted as the best seasons of the year to shop for laptop deals, we're certainly not ruling out Boxing Day sales and the second January sales situation. Major retailers are clearly going to be looking to compete with great options on everything from entry-level Chromebooks to high-end gaming laptops, and not just displace old inventory. Best of all, the large-scale global chip shortage hasn't really hurt the UK laptop market, which means retail shelves are expected to be partially well-stocked by Boxing Day. We expect manufacturers like Dell and HP to offer great options direct through their sites, with Amazon, Currys, Box, Notebooks Direct, and Very being the most options at major retailers.
